117.info
人生若只如初见

MySQL的uroot用户的权限如何限制

要限制MySQL的uroot用户的权限,可以使用GRANT和REVOKE语句来授予或撤销权限。以下是一些常见的方法来限制uroot用户的权限:

  1. 只授予必要的权限:只授予uroot用户必要的权限,如SELECT、INSERT、UPDATE、DELETE等,避免授予过多权限。

  2. 限制用户访问的数据库:使用GRANT语句授予uroot用户只能访问特定的数据库,可以通过以下语句实现:

    GRANT SELECT, INSERT, UPDATE, DELETE ON database_name.* TO 'uroot'@'localhost';
    
  3. 限制用户的IP地址:使用GRANT语句限制uroot用户只能从特定的IP地址访问MySQL服务器,可以通过以下语句实现:

    GRANT ALL PRIVILEGES ON *.* TO 'uroot'@'192.168.1.100' IDENTIFIED BY 'password';
    
  4. 撤销权限:使用REVOKE语句撤销uroot用户的不必要的权限,可以通过以下语句实现:

    REVOKE CREATE, DROP, ALTER ON *.* FROM 'uroot'@'localhost';
    

通过以上方法,可以有效地限制MySQL的uroot用户的权限,从而保障数据库的安全性。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e717AzsABAZVAg.html

推荐文章

  • MySQL许可证有哪些常见问题

    MySQL的许可证常见问题包括: 是否需要付费购买MySQL许可证?MySQL有两种许可证,一种是开源的GPL许可证,可以免费使用;另一种是商业许可证,需要付费购买。 使...

  • MySQL许可证是否需要备份

    MySQL许可证并不需要备份。许可证是一份文件,通常保存在您的计算机或服务器上的特定位置,用于验证您的软件许可。您可以将许可证文件复制到其他位置作为备份,以...

  • MySQL许可证支持哪些版本

    MySQL许可证支持以下版本: MySQL Community Edition
    MySQL Standard Edition
    MySQL Enterprise Edition 每个版本都有不同的许可证和功能,用户可以根...

  • MySQL许可证如何升级

    MySQL 许可证的升级一般需要购买相应的许可证升级服务。您可以通过 MySQL 官方网站或者 MySQL 认可的经销商获取更多关于许可证升级的信息。通常升级许可证需要支...

  • MySQL的uroot用户是否可以远程登录

    在默认情况下,MySQL的root用户是可以远程登录的。但是,需要注意的是,为了安全起见,最好限制远程登录的权限,只允许特定的IP地址或主机访问数据库。可以通过修...

  • MySQL中uroot用户的登录密码如何保护

    在MySQL中,可以通过以下方法来保护uroot用户的登录密码: 使用强密码:确保密码足够长、复杂,并包含大小写字母、数字和特殊字符。 使用SSL加密连接:通过SSL加...

  • 如何修改MySQL的uroot用户密码

    要修改MySQL的root用户密码,可以使用以下步骤: 连接到MySQL数据库服务器。可以使用以下命令连接到MySQL服务器: mysql -u root -p 输入当前的root用户密码,然...

  • MySQL中uroot用户的权限如何分配

    在MySQL中,可以使用GRANT语句来分配用户的权限。要给root用户分配权限,可以按照以下步骤进行: 登录MySQL数据库,使用root用户或具有SUPER权限的用户。 使用以...